POUGHKEEPSIE, NY -- The RIT (9-13, 5-8 Liberty League) women's basketball team had their four-game winning streak snapped on Saturday with an 85-75 loss at Vassar College. #

RIT jumped out quick, scoring the first eight points of the game. Wheeler, Tennant and Havens each scored for the Tigers to help build an eight point lead.
Vassar came back, taking thier first lead of the half on a pair of free throws by Colleen O'Connell at the 10:10 mark to give the Brewers a 17-16 lead.
The Brewers went on a 12-0 run over a 4:17 period, building their lead to 41-29 on a bucket by Natalie Allen with 1:50 to play in the half.
RIT was able to finish the half strong, trailing 43-36 at the break.
Tennant led RIT with 12 first half points, shooting 4-of-5 from the field. Wheeler added six points for the Tigers who shot 38 percent from the floor in the first half on 13-of-34 shooting. Vassar held a 23-15 rebounding edge.
A quick 4-0 spurt by RIT early in the second half cut Vassar's lead to 47-43 on a jumper by Wheeler with 16:04 to play.
That would be as close as the Tigers would get in the second half, as Vassar went on a 13-4 run, opening up a 13-point lead on a free throw by Hannah Senftleber with 10:43 to play.
RIT would get no closer than seven points down the stretch.
RIT shot 39 percent from the floor on 27-of-69 shooting. The Tigers were 6-of-21 from three point land and made 15-of-22 free throws.
Vassar shot 50 percent from the floor and held a 52-33 rebounding edge. Five Brewers scored in double figures led by 17 points from Cydni Matsuoka. O'Connell added 14 points and nine rebounds, while Natalie Allen scored 10 points and grabbed eight rebounds.
